I have a database in a worksheet with several columns (with headers).
From a VBA input sheet, I would like to be able to search a database
using the Last Name column - say column B - as my key search, locate
the row the Last Name is on, and go to a specific cell on that row -
say in column P - and edit the data in that cell. I'm sure this is
child's play for some of you but I have not had any luck so far with
the right code.
